What is the difference between overinflated and underinflated tires?

The difference between overinflated and underinflated tires lies in their impact on vehicle performance, safety, and tire longevity. Overinflated tires have too much air pressure, leading to a harder ride and uneven wear, while underinflated tires have insufficient air pressure, causing increased rolling resistance, reduced fuel efficiency, and potential safety hazards.

What Are the Effects of Overinflated Tires?

Overinflated tires can lead to several issues that affect your driving experience and tire durability:

  • Reduced Traction: With too much air, the tire’s contact patch with the road decreases, reducing traction and increasing the risk of slipping, especially in wet conditions.
  • Uneven Wear: Overinflation causes the center of the tire to wear out faster than the edges, leading to premature tire replacement.
  • Harsh Ride Quality: More air pressure results in a stiffer tire, translating to a bumpier ride as the tires absorb less shock from road imperfections.

What Are the Consequences of Underinflated Tires?

Underinflated tires pose different challenges, impacting safety and efficiency:

  • Increased Rolling Resistance: Insufficient air pressure makes tires softer, increasing rolling resistance and leading to higher fuel consumption.
  • Heat Buildup: Underinflated tires flex more, generating excess heat which can cause tire failure or blowouts.
  • Shortened Tire Lifespan: The edges of underinflated tires wear out faster, resulting in uneven tread wear and a need for more frequent replacements.

Why Is Maintaining Proper Tire Pressure Important?

Maintaining the correct tire pressure is crucial for several reasons:

  • Safety: Properly inflated tires ensure optimal traction and handling, reducing the risk of accidents.
  • Fuel Efficiency: Correct tire pressure minimizes rolling resistance, improving fuel economy and reducing emissions.
  • Tire Longevity: Balanced pressure helps distribute wear evenly across the tire’s surface, extending its lifespan and saving money on replacements.

How Can You Check and Maintain Tire Pressure?

Regularly checking and maintaining tire pressure is a simple yet effective way to enhance vehicle performance and safety. Here’s how you can do it:

  1. Use a Reliable Tire Pressure Gauge: Digital or analog gauges provide accurate readings. Check pressure when tires are cold for the most accurate measurement.
  2. Refer to the Manufacturer’s Specifications: Find the recommended tire pressure in the owner’s manual or on the driver’s side door placard.
  3. Inspect Tires Monthly: Regular checks help catch pressure changes due to temperature fluctuations or slow leaks.
  4. Adjust Pressure as Needed: Add or release air to maintain the recommended pressure levels, ensuring even wear and optimal performance.

Common Questions About Tire Pressure

How Often Should You Check Tire Pressure?

It’s advisable to check tire pressure at least once a month and before long trips. Regular checks can prevent issues related to both overinflation and underinflation.

What Tools Do You Need to Check Tire Pressure?

A reliable tire pressure gauge is essential. You can choose between digital and analog options, both of which are widely available at automotive stores.

Can Temperature Affect Tire Pressure?

Yes, temperature changes can significantly affect tire pressure. For every 10°F change in temperature, tire pressure can change by approximately 1 PSI. Cold weather typically lowers tire pressure, while hot weather increases it.

What Are the Signs of Incorrect Tire Pressure?

Signs of incorrect tire pressure include uneven tire wear, reduced fuel efficiency, a rough ride, or poor handling. Regular inspections can help you spot these issues early.

Is It Safe to Drive with Overinflated or Underinflated Tires?

Driving with incorrect tire pressure is not safe. Both overinflated and underinflated tires can compromise vehicle handling, increase the risk of tire damage, and lead to accidents.
